From: Christian Brauner Date: Fri, 11 May 2018 13:58:33 +0000 (+0200) Subject: tools: s/strncpy()/memcpy()/ X-Git-Tag: lxc-3.1.0~307^2 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=refs%2Fpull%2F2318%2Fhead;p=thirdparty%2Flxc.git tools: s/strncpy()/memcpy()/ Signed-off-by: Christian Brauner --- diff --git a/src/lxc/tools/lxc_monitor.c b/src/lxc/tools/lxc_monitor.c index 050b5519b..abc8a233a 100644 --- a/src/lxc/tools/lxc_monitor.c +++ b/src/lxc/tools/lxc_monitor.c @@ -319,7 +319,7 @@ static int lxc_abstract_unix_connect(const char *path) return -1; } /* addr.sun_path[0] has already been set to 0 by memset() */ - strncpy(&addr.sun_path[1], &path[1], strlen(&path[1])); + memcpy(&addr.sun_path[1], &path[1], strlen(&path[1])); ret = connect(fd, (struct sockaddr *)&addr, offsetof(struct sockaddr_un, sun_path) + len + 1);